Ken Lerner is an American actor who, among other roles, played "Principal Flutie" in the first episodes of the television series Buffy the Vampire Slayer.
Lerner was born in Brooklyn, New York, the son of Blanche and George Lerner, who was a fisherman and antiques dealer.1 He is the brother of fellow actor Michael Lerner. He's well known for playing whiny or unlucky characters, like the agent who Arnold Schwarzenegger stabs in the back with a pen in The Running Man.
